A two-year-old boy is in critical condition after being attacked by an Amstaff dog in the yard of some relatives. The incident occurred when the child's mother entered the yard with him to have a meal. Three dangerous dogs were loose, and one of them lunged at the little boy, causing him serious injuries to his neck, face, and head. The mother tried to save him but was unsuccessful. Witnesses described the scene as devastating, with the child covered in blood and the mother in shock.
The boy was rushed to Grigore Alexandrescu Hospital, where doctors were shocked by the severity of his injuries. The dog owners and the child's parents are now under investigation, and neighbors have reported the aggressive behavior of the dogs in the yard. The Amstaff breed is considered dangerous and must be registered and kept in safe conditions. This incident brings back painful memories of other dog attacks, including the tragic case of Ionuț in 2013.
